The Lost Apothecary (Limited Edition) is a haunting historical thriller weaving together the lives of women across centuries.
In eighteenth-century London, an apothecary named Nella operates a secret shop, selling poisons to women seeking freedom from their oppressors. Her business follows strict rules:

Never use poison against another woman;

The names of the killer and the victim must be recorded in the apothecary’s registry.
In modern-day London, historian Caroline Parswell, reeling from her husband’s betrayal, stumbles upon an antique vial. This discovery entangles her in a web of century-old murders of apothecaries. As Caroline, Nella, and a 12-year-old girl named Eliza Fanning see their stories converge, the stakes rise — secrets, retribution, and survival hang in the balance.
The novel explores female agency, vengeance, hidden histories, and the echoes of the past in the present.
